>> This PR will fix not only JDK-8355371 but also JDK-8354910. I chose the more serious one.
>> 
>> Note: according to JEP-512 (JDK-8344699), java.io.IO is going to stop using System.console().
>> I confirmed it by checking out and building https://github.com/openjdk/jdk/pull/24438. (in that PR, the bug does not occur in `IO.print(ln)`)
>> 
>> Before (Temurin 24):
>> 
>> 
>> jshell> IO.println("a".repeat(128))
>> Exception in thread "output reader" java.lang.NegativeArraySizeException: -128
